WebApr 7, 2024 · Open to all salmon June 24 through the earlier of Sept. 30 or 79,800 adipose fin-clipped coho quota or the 11,490 Chinook guideline. Daily bag limit: two salmon but no more than one can be Chinook, and coho must be fin-clipped. Chinook minimum length: 22 inches. Coho minimum length: 16 inches. WebJan 20, 2024 · Crabbing is legal and open in bays, beaches, tide pools, piers, and jetties year-round on the Oregon coast. With that being said, September through November is usually the best time to crab. You’ll also have come luck late summer and early winter. If you go anytime of year, it’s hard to find crabs large enough to keep. WebBays, beaches, estuaries, tide pools, piers and jetties are open for crabbing all year, 24 hours per day. Ocean waters are closed for Dungeness crab Oct. 16 – Nov. 30.
